Endotracheal suction interventions in mechanically ventilated children: An integrative review to inform evidence-based practice
Abstract
Objective The objective of this study was to review and critically appraise the evidence for paediatric endotracheal suction interventions. Data sources A systematic search for studies was undertaken in the electronic databases CENTRAL, Medline, EMBASE, and EBSCO CINAHL from 2003. Study selection Included studies assessed suction interventions in children (≤18 ys old) receiving mechanical ventilation. The primary outcome was defined a priori as...
